NAME
       libssh2_channel_receive_window_adjust - adjust the channel window

SYNOPSIS
       #include	<libssh2.h>

       unsigned	long
       libssh2_channel_receive_window_adjust(LIBSSH2_CHANNEL * channel,
					     unsigned long adjustment,
					     unsigned char force);

DESCRIPTION
       This  function  is  DEPRECATED  in  1.1.0.  Use the libssh2_channel_re-
       ceive_window_adjust2(3) function	instead!

       Adjust the receive window for a channel by  adjustment  bytes.  If  the
       amount  to be adjusted is less than LIBSSH2_CHANNEL_MINADJUST and force
       is 0 the	adjustment amount will be queued for a later packet.

RETURN VALUE
       Returns the new size of the receive window  (as	understood  by	remote
       end).  Note that	the window value sent over the wire is strictly	32bit,
       but this	API is made to return a	'long' which may not be	32 bit on  all
       platforms.

ERRORS
       In 1.0 and earlier, this	function returns LIBSSH2_ERROR_EAGAIN for non-
       blocking	 channels  where  it would otherwise block. However, that is a
       negative	number and this	function only returns an  unsigned  value  and
       this then leads to a very strange value being returned.
